Trump-appointed judge Aileen Cannon continues to wear her Trump favoritism on her sleeve. A number of motions filed by Jack Smith have languished, remaining unresolved for months.
As but one example, back in May, Smith filed a motion asking Judge Cannon to modify Trump's conditions of release to stop him from lying about and endangering FBI agents. Cannon has sat on that motion.
However, on Friday, Trump filed a motion asking Cannon to stay or pause a number of deadlines in his Florida case while he briefs-up issues regarding presidential immunity.
Judge Cannon acted on Trump's motion IN LESS THAN 24 HOURS, ruling in his favor and giving him precisely what he wants.
As has long been the case, Cannon's "impartiality might reasonably be questioned," which is the federal legal standard requiring her disqualification from the case.
